Celtic reportedly eyeing Manchester United star that Souness hammered in 2019

Add as preferred source on Google

Celtic are reportedly battling seven Premier League clubs for Manchester United defender Phil Jones with the England international yet to make a single outing this season – but Graeme Souness’ comments from 2019 are hardly encouraging.

Jones, 28, was left out of the 25-man Premier League squad by Ole Gunnar Solskjaer in the summer – and has failed to get any game time in the cup competitions or in Europe. He is way down the pecking order and completely surplus to requirements.

Indeed, Axel Tuanzebe, Harry Maguire, Victor Lindelof and Eric Bailly are preferred to Jones – with Marcos Rojo also on the sidelines while Chris Smalling has joined Roma permanently. 90Min state that eight teams are interested in Jones.

Celtic are one of those, along with seven Premier League clubs – Newcastle, West Ham, Sheffield United, Southampton, Burnley, Leicester and Palace. Souness was damning in his verdict of Jones after a 3-3 draw with Sheffield United in November 2019.

“He’s just done everything wrong. He’s in the wrong position,” Souness said as per the Mail – after his mistake for Lys Mousset’s goal. “Jones isn’t a cute player. He’s not 20 years old. He’s not got the greatest touch. At worst give away a throw in.”

TBR’s view – Surely Celtic can get better value for money?

The Sun claim United want £20million for Jones, while the ex-Blackburn defender is said to be earning £75,000 a week (Spotrac) at Old Trafford. A permanent deal is out of the question, while a loan fee might prove too expensive.

Celtic should only consider a move for Jones if they can get the Manchester United man on loan for a small-ish loan fee and with United paying the majority of his wages. Otherwise, the Hoops need to look elsewhere to bolster their defender.
